Subject: [PATCH rcu 2/5] torture: Make torture.sh print the number of files to be compressed
Date: Wed, 15 Sep 2021 17:27:57 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210916002800.3910056-2-paulmck@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210916002710.GA3909915@paulmck-ThinkPad-P17-Gen-1>

Compressing gigabyte vmlinux files can take some time, and it can be a
bit annoying to not know many more batches of compression there will be.
This commit therefore makes torture.sh print the number of files to be
compressed just before starting compression and just after compression
completes.

 tools/testing/selftests/rcutorture/bin/torture.sh | 9 +++++++--
 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/rcutorture/bin/torture.sh b/tools/testing/selftests/rcutorture/bin/torture.sh
index 363f56081eff..8e882346d2a6 100755
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/rcutorture/bin/torture.sh
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/rcutorture/bin/torture.sh
@@ -434,7 +434,12 @@ then
 	batchno=1
 	if test -s $T/xz-todo
 	then
-		echo Size before compressing: `du -sh $tdir | awk '{ print $1 }'` `date` 2>&1 | tee -a "$tdir/log-xz" | tee -a $T/log
+		for i in `cat $T/xz-todo`
+		do
+			find $i -name 'vmlinux*' -print
+		done | wc -l | awk '{ print $1 }' > $T/xz-todo-count
+		n2compress="`cat $T/xz-todo-count`"
+		echo Size before compressing $n2compress files: `du -sh $tdir | awk '{ print $1 }'` `date` 2>&1 | tee -a "$tdir/log-xz" | tee -a $T/log
 		for i in `cat $T/xz-todo`
 		do
 			echo Compressing vmlinux files in ${i}: `date` >> "$tdir/log-xz" 2>&1
@@ -456,7 +461,7 @@ then
 			echo Waiting for final batch $batchno of $ncompresses compressions `date` | tee -a "$tdir/log-xz" | tee -a $T/log
 		fi
 		wait
-		echo Size after compressing: `du -sh $tdir | awk '{ print $1 }'` `date` 2>&1 | tee -a "$tdir/log-xz" | tee -a $T/log
+		echo Size after compressing $n2compress files: `du -sh $tdir | awk '{ print $1 }'` `date` 2>&1 | tee -a "$tdir/log-xz" | tee -a $T/log
 		echo Total duration `get_starttime_duration $starttime`. | tee -a $T/log
 	else
 		echo No compression needed: `date` >> "$tdir/log-xz" 2>&1
